Location:
Founded in 1836, Shreveport is located along the west bank of the Red River in
northwest Louisiana and is the educational, commercial, and cultural center of the Ark-La-Tex region
where these three states meet.
The city is located 190 miles from Dallas, TX, 215 miles from Little
Rock, AR, and 250 miles from the states capital, Baton Rouge. Shreveport is Louisiana's third
most-populous city after New Orleans and Baton Rouge with a metro population of over 261,000
residents and a regional draw of approximately 1.2 million.
Given its proximity to nearby cities,
Shreveport serves as the transportation hub of the region and has thrice been named an All-American
City in 1953, 1979, and 1999. Companies with significant operations or headquarters in Shreveport
include Amazon, Regions, Financial Corporation, JP Morgan Chase, Sams Hotel and Gambling Hall, AT&T
Mobility, UPS, Walmart, Chick-fil-A, Waffle House, SWEPCO, General Electric, UOP, LLC, Calumet
Specialty Products Partners, APS Payroll, Barksdale Airforce Base (BAFB), and the Cyber Innovation
Center which anchors the 3,000-acre National Cyber Research Park. Outstanding public and private
schools also make Shreveport a desirable location to raise a family.
